Transaction 221ee7b26f6ec92847524481cf20f79df964f08a88afd3f3aabf594def41636f
4 Input
2 Outputs
- 221ee7b26f6ec92847524481cf20f79df964f08a88afd3f3aabf594def41636f:0
- 221ee7b26f6ec92847524481cf20f79df964f08a88afd3f3aabf594def41636f:1
value 1760000000
address 17KYmanVj224z6waGxgsXybxxRydbXLPmw
value 892757281
address 15tcjZgx6NGP232Ps3BzAiPNZ1HiSzBRKN